Abstract

Patients with systemic sclerosis may have overlap or features of other autoimmune diseases. Autoimmune hepatitis is an inflammatory chronic liver disease of idiopathic origin. It has features of prominent autoimmunity, such as specific autoantibodies and hypergammaglobulinemia. Here we describe a case of a middle-aged female who presented with anorexia and jaundice who turned out to have a conundrum of autoimmune disorders.
